English Definitions:
hop (noun)
the act of hopping; jumping upward or forward (especially on one foot)
hop, hops (noun)
twining perennials having cordate leaves and flowers arranged in conelike spikes; the dried flowers of this plant are used in brewing to add the characteristic bitter taste to beer
hop, record hop (verb)
an informal dance where popular music is played
hop, skip, hop-skip (verb)
jump lightly
hop (verb)
move quickly from one place to another
hop (verb)
travel by means of an aircraft, bus, etc.
"She hopped a train to Chicago"; "He hopped rides all over the country"
hop (verb)
traverse as if by a short airplane trip
"Hop the Pacific Ocean"
hop (verb)
jump across
"He hopped the bush"
hop (verb)
make a jump forward or upward
hop (Noun)
a narcotic drug, usually opium
Hop
Humulus, hop, is a small genus of flowering plants in the family Cannabaceae, which also includes cannabis. The hop is native to temperate regions of the Northern Hemisphere. The species H. lupulus is the main flavour ingredient in many types of beer, and as such is widely cultivated for use by the brewing industry.
